@charset "utf-8";
/* CSS Document */

/*5*/
body { margin: 0px; padding: 0px; font-size: 14px; color: #494949; background-image:url(images/line1.gif); line-height:22px; }
ul,li{ padding:0px; margin:0px; list-style-type: none; }
.left{ float:left; }
.left ul,li { padding:0; margin:0; float:left; }
.bold{ font-weight:bold; font-size:14px; }
.bold2{ font-weight:bold; font-size:12px; }
h2{ font-size:14px; font-weight:bold; padding:0; margin:0; color:#fff; }
h3{ font-size:14px; font-weight:bold; padding:0; margin:0; color:#494949; }

/*3*/
a:link{ color: #000; text-decoration: none; }
a:visited{ color:#000; text-decoration: none; }
a:hover{ color:#f60; text-decoration: underline; }

/*2*/
.header{ width:955px; height:20px; margin:0 auto; padding:7px 0 0 5px;}
.header img { padding:0 5px;}
.header a{ text-decoration:none; font-weight:bold; }
.header a:link{ text-decoration:none; }
.header a:visited{ text-decoration:none; }
.header a:hover{ text-decoration:underline; color:#f60; }

/*banner*/
.banner{ width:960px; height:184px; margin:0 auto; padding:0; }

/*main*/
.main1{ width:941px; height:217px; margin:0 auto; background-color:#fff; padding:7px 9px 11px 10px; }
.main1_left{ width:297px; height:217px; float:left; }
.lunbotu1{ width:297px; height:5px; float:left; }
.lunbotu2{ width:275px; height:192px; float:left; background-image:url(images/xzbmb_02.gif); padding:5px 11px; }
.lunbotu3{ width:297px; height:10px; float:left; }
.main1_center{ width:7px; height:217px; float:left; }
.main1_right{ width:636px; height:217px; float:left; }
.dingyi1{ width:636px; height:5px; float:left; }
.dingyi2{ width:596px; height:192px; float:left; background-image:url(images/xzbmb_05.gif); padding:10px 20px 0;}
.dingyi3{ width:636px; height:10px; float:left; }
.main2{ width:910px; height:88px; margin:0 auto; background-image:url(images/xzbmb_07.gif); padding:18px 25px 15px;}
.pic1{ width:109px; height:88px; padding-right:20px; float:left;}
.fxb{ width:780px; height:88px; float:left;}
.main3{ width:940px; height:810px; margin:0 auto; padding:0 9px 0 11px; }
.main3_left{ width:682px; float:left; }
.changjian{ width:637px; height:25px; float:left; background-image:url(images/xzbmb_08.gif);padding:5px 15px 0 30px; margin-top:10px; }
.titile{ float:left; color:#fff; font-weight:bold; }
.zixun{ float:right; color:#f60; font-weight:bold; text-decoration:underline; }
.zixun a{ color:#f60; font-weight:bold; text-decoration:underline; }
.zixun a:link{ color:#f60; font-weight:bold; text-decoration:underline; }
.zixun a:visited{ color:#f60; font-weight:bold; text-decoration:underline; }
.zixun a:hover{ color:#f60; font-weight:bold; text-decoration:none; }
.changjian_content{ width:682px; float:left; }
.pic2{ width:183px; height:141px; float:left; padding:10px 0 0 13px; }
.text1{ width:456px; float:left; padding:10px 10px 0 20px; }
.line1{ border-bottom:1px dotted #ededed; }
.text2{ float:left; width:210px; padding:0; margin:0; }
.biaoti1{ width:450px; float:left; padding:10px 0 0 0; margin:0;}
.biaoti1 ul{ float:left; padding:0; margin:0; }
.biaoti1 li{ width:450px; float:left; padding:0; margin:0; }
.waike{ width:637px; height:25px; float:left; background-image:url(images/xzbmb_08.gif);padding:5px 15px 0 30px; margin-top:10px; }
.waike_content{ width:652px; float:left; padding:10px 15px; }
.text3{ float:left; font-weight:bold; padding:0 0 5px 0; }
.biaoti2{ width:652px; float:left; padding:5px 0 0 0; margin:0;}
.biaoti2 ul{ float:left; padding:0; margin:0; }
.biaoti2 li{ width:652px; float:left; padding:0; margin:0; }

.main3_right{ width:239px; float:left; padding-left:18px; }
.zxzx{ width:239px; height:48px; float:left; padding-bottom:5px; }
.zjdy{ width:239px; height:48px; float:left; padding-bottom:5px; }
.dianhua{ width:239px; height:43px; float:left; padding-bottom:5px; }
.zjzx{ width:239px; height:195px; float:left; margin-bottom:8px; }
.right_title{ width:211px; height:22px; float:left; background-image:url(images/xzbmb_12.gif); font-weight:bold; padding:8px 0 0 28px; }
.zjzx_content{ width:239px; height:157px; float:left; background-image:url(images/xzbmb_13.gif);  }
.right_bottom{ width:239px; height:8px; float:left; padding:0; }
.zj{ width:204px; float:left; padding:10px 15px 0 20px; }
.pic3{ width:86px; height:112px; float:left; }
.zjzl{ width:105px; height:112px; float:left; padding:0 0 0 13px; font-size:12px; }
.btn1{ width:219px; float:left; padding:5px 0 0 20px; font-size:12px; }
.btn1 img{ padding:0 5px 0 0;}
.bingfazheng{ width:239px; height:112px; float:left; margin-bottom:8px; }
.bingfazheng_content{ width:214px; height:69px; float:left; background-image:url(images/xzbmb_13.gif); font-size:12px; padding:5px 10px 0 15px; }
.biaozhun{ width:239px; height:314px; float:left; }
.biaozhun_content{ width:214px; height:271px; float:left; background-image:url(images/xzbmb_13.gif); font-size:12px; padding:5px 10px 0 15px; }
.banner2{ width:682px; height:80px; float:left; }

/*1*/
.hzmt{ width:945px; height:80px; padding:8px 0 0 15px; margin:0 auto; background-image:url(images/bottom.gif); }

#end_nav{ width:958px; display:block; clear:both; margin:8px auto; background-color:#FAFAFA; height:60px; overflow:hidden; padding:10px 0px;}
#end_nav li{ height:20px; line-height:20px; }
.box_border{ border: 1px solid #F6DCC5; }
.about,.guide,.ill{
	float:left;
	display:inline;
	margin-left:40px;
	}
.about dl,.guide dl{
	margin:0;
	padding:0 40px 0 0;
	width:240px;
	border-right:1px dotted #ccc;
	}
.ill dl{
	border:0;
	}
.about dl dt,.guide dl dt,.ill dl dt{
	height:18px;
	color:#FF6501;
	}
.about dl dt a,.guide dl dt a,.ill dl dt a{
	font-weight:bold;
	font-size:12px;
	color:#FF6501;
	}
.about dl dt,.guide dl dt,.ill dl dt,.about dl dd,.guide dl dd,.ill dl dd{
	margin:0;
	padding:0;
	}
.about dl dd,.guide dl dd,.ill dl dd{
	line-height:20px;
	}
.about dl dd a,.guide dl dd a,.ill dl dd a{
	font-size:12px;
	color:#333;
	}
.about dl dt a:hover,.guide dl dt a:hover,.ill dl dt a:hover,.about dl dd a:hover,.guide dl dd a:hover,.ill dl dd a:hover{
	color:#FF6501;
	}
	



#footer{ margin:0px auto; padding:10px 0 18px 0; width:960px;clear:both; }
#footer p{
	margin:0;
	padding:0;
	font:12px "Tahoma";
	line-height:22px;
	text-align:center;
	}